I had great results dealing with their warranty department. I had purchased a new 26" to replace my 22" Deluxe Performer that we were moving to our permanent campsite. My plan was to build a cart for the 26" similar to the Performer.
After having the grill for about a month, I noticed some rust in a few spots. After inspecting further, I found quite a few areas missing finishing or finish flaked off. I had not used it or did a burn in, I simply purchased it, loaded into my truck (already assembled), and unloaded at home. The lid and bowl were wrapped individually in moving blankets to protect the finish.
The problem areas on the bowl were where the legs attached (some rust coming out after rain on the exterior and the finish flaked off on the interior where they attached), and the handle. There was some finish missing where it looked like it had been stressed and there was rust coming out of the seam (where the handle attached to the bowl) after rain.
The lid had missing or flaked off finish around the vent holes.
I contacted Weber (via their website) and received a response the next day. They requested the usual information. I sent them pictures of all the problem areas and said that I had excellent results with my 22" performer that has lived its entire life outdoors. About a few weeks later, I received a brand new bowl and lid!
